Dos Anjos burns Covington after callout: 'I had to Google your name'
Yet to make his debut at 170 pounds, former UFC lightweight champion Rafael dos Anjos is already getting plenty of attention in his new division.
On Monday, welterweight Colby Covington responded to an article about Dos Anjos' financial motivation for changing weight classes by lobbying for a fight with the Brazilian star:
What makes financial sense is me whooping your ass in your back yard at #ufc212 @RdosAnjosMMA @ufc @seanshelby @danawhite https://t.co/ocQiSRXOnz
— Colby Covington (@ColbyCovMMA) March 13, 2017
He followed up with another tweet claiming Dos Anjos isn't worthy of a big-name opponent just yet, prompting the latter to offer a Conor McGregor-like response:
@ColbyCovMMA hey man, I had to google your name to know how you are. Keep begging.
— Rafael dos Anjos (@RdosAnjosMMA) March 14, 2017
Covington is riding a three-fight win streak and sports a healthy 6-1 record inside the Octagon, but it's fair to say he caught an L in this exchange.
